Item 1.01.
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.

On July 22, 2020, 9 Meters Biopharma, Inc. (the “Company”) entered into a Sales Agreement (the “Agreement”) with SunTrust Robinson Humphrey, Inc. (“SunTrust”) under which the Company may offer and sell, from time to time at its sole discretion, shares of its common stock, par value $0.0001 per share (the “Common Stock”), having an aggregate offering price of up to $40 million through SunTrust as its sales agent. The issuance and sale of shares of Common Stock, if any, by the Company under the Agreement will be pursuant to the Company’s Registration Statement on Form S-3 (File No. 333-223669) fil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ission (the “SEC”) on March 15, 2018 (the “Registration Statement”) and declared effective by the SEC on July 13, 2018, the prospectus supplement relating to the offering filed with the SEC on July 22, 2020 (the "Offering"), and any applicable additional prospectus supplements related to the Offering that form a part of the Registration Statement.
 
Subject to the terms and conditions of the Agreement, SunTrust may sell the Common Stock by any method permitted by law deemed to be an “at the market offering” as defined in Rule 415(a)(4) of the Securities Act of 1933, as amended. SunTrust will use commercially reasonable efforts to sell the Common Stock from time to time, based upon instructions from the Company (including any price, time or size limits or other customary parameters or conditions the Company may impose). The Company will pay SunTrust a commission equal to up to three percent (3.0%) of the gross sales proceeds of any Common Stock sold through SunTrust under the Agreement, and also has provided SunTrust with certain indemnification rights.
 
The Company is not obligated to make any sales of Common Stock under the Agreement. The offering of shares of Common Stock pursuant to the Agreement will terminate upon the earlier of (i) the sale of all Common Stock subject to the Agreement or (ii) termination of the Agreement in accordance with its terms.
 
The foregoing description of the Agreement is not complete and is qualified in its entirety by reference to the full text of the Agreement, a copy of which is filed herewith as Exhibit 1.1 to this Current Report on Form 8-K and is incorporated herein by reference.
